    King of Tortuga is a pirate-themed player elimination card game for up to eight players. The setting is the pirate enclave of Tortuga during the heyday of piracy in the early 18th century where a number of crews are in the city and decide to fight to see who is the best. As the Captain of the crew if you are successful you will be declared the King of Tortuga and the the most powerful pirate this side of Blackbeard.

    The game is easy - each player is given five cards that have a variety of attack, defense and special cards. Each card has either a point value and/or an explanation of what they do to let you know what to do. Each player also is given 12 markers. The markers represent your crew. As your crew inflicts damage your opponents will lose more crew members until eliminated until opponents are gone... but you.
